Meme Alert: Twitter Loves Akshay Kumar’s Dialogue ‘CHAL JHOOTA’ In ‘Kesari’

Darpan News Desk IANS, 22 Feb, 2019 09:38 PM

    With 20 million views in 24 hours, Akshay Kumar’s upcoming drama, ‘Kesari’ has become a fan favourite. The 3 minute video turned into a hilarious meme in seconds.

     

    Akshay will play the role of a military commander of 21 Sikh soldiers named Havildar Ishar Singh. Parineeti Chopra is the leading lady of the film.

     
     
     
     

    The trailer features a scene where Akshay says, 'Chal Jhoota' to an Afghan warrior.

     

    Akshay’s dialogues in the trailer gave twitter an opportunity to create new and a hilarious memes.

     
     

    Fan’s reactions:

     
     
     
     
     
     
     
     
     
     
     
     
     
     
     
     

    ‘Kesari’ is based on the Battle of Saragarhi where 21 Sikhs fought against 10,000 Afghans in 1897.

     

    ‘Kesari’ is produced by filmmaker Karan Johar’s Dharma Productions. ‘Kesari' is directed by popular Punjabi director Anurag Singh.

     

    The film is scheduled to release on March 21.

     

    Akshay will also be seen in ‘Good News’, ‘Mission Mangal’ and ‘Housefull 4’.
